Transaction 3496a089afc9012182af5d569ae7964022b28c76545849065c31ca81023b964f
1 Input
1 Output
-
3496a089afc9012182af5d569ae7964022b28c76545849065c31ca81023b964f:0
- value
- 1379129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8192e37d83df30926fd6557a705002b18f00c7c OP_EQUAL
- address
- 3Kw3EV3nTVzSbS91Mgzmu9Uyg2sMWNmJuV